Tour Overview
Embark on a 6-day, 5-night luxury adventure through Kenya's most iconic landscapes, including the Masai Mara, Lake Nakuru, and Amboseli. Begin your journey with a thrilling game drive in the Masai Mara, where you'll encounter the Big Five and traverse the stunning Great African Rift Valley. Continue to Lake Nakuru, renowned for its vibrant flamingo population and diverse wildlife. Experience a boat ride on Lake Naivasha before heading to Amboseli, where you'll witness majestic elephants and hippos against the backdrop of Mount Kilimanjaro's snow-capped peaks. Enjoy full-day game viewing, delicious meals, and comfortable accommodations throughout this unforgettable safari.

After the main breakfast, depart to Amboseli. You will be arriving at around 4:30 pm local hours, but you will have a chance to drive in the park. You will get to see how dust devils swirl around the edges, but in the heart of the park is a great swamp in which elephants and hippos are in abundance. A visit to the observation hill will follow, where you will get to see how zebras mate. In addition to that, you will have a look at the glistering majestic snowcap at MT Kilimanjaro. Amboseli is famous for its big game elephants living beside the most celebrated culture in the world-Masai. However, lunch meals and leisure break will be at the campsite in the mid-afternoon. Dinner and overnight will be at Eco Camp.
